What Goes Into Architecture Plans?
Architecture plans are technical documents that communicate the full design of a structure before work begins. They typically contain floor plans, elevation drawings, structural layouts, mechanical and electrical schematics, and material specifications. These documents serve the primary reference guide between the client, the architect, the contractor, and the local building department.
Mechanically, the development of architecture plans draws from multiple professional fields working together. A certified architect converts your requirements into scaled documents that incorporate structural engineering, zoning laws, lot coverage rules, and material capabilities. The result is a set of documents that guides each contractor exactly what to do and in what manner.

The Architecture Plans Process Step by Step
- Defining the Vision — Our professionals begin by conducting a thorough intake to understand your goals. We review the intended use of the space, your financial parameters, your target completion date, and any specific design preferences you have in mind. This early conversation guides the entire direction of your architecture plans.
- Site Analysis and Condition Review — Before any drawing begins, our experts conduct a thorough on-site evaluation. We examine lot dimensions, access points, easements and setbacks, and drainage patterns that will shape the architecture plans.
- Creating the Initial Design Concept — With assessment findings in hand, our design team develop schematic drawings that illustrate the design intent. These early documents allow you to review the spatial arrangement of your project and request adjustments before we advance further into detailed documentation.
- Design Development and Technical Detailing — After client sign-off, our designers move into full detailed drawing. This phase is where architecture plans take their final form. We incorporate electrical pathways, material specifications, and precisely scaled floor plans and sections.
- Preparing Your Filing Package — Our experts assemble the complete set of architecture plans into a permit-ready package that satisfies every local municipal requirements. We manage the code analysis and work with your builder to ensure everything is aligned.
- Addressing Reviewer Comments — Most applications go through at least one plan check cycle. Our team address plan check items without delay, updating your architecture plans to satisfy all outstanding issues.
- Ongoing Field Coordination — Once permits are approved, our experts remain available throughout the build phase. We answer questions as site realities demand them, and we prepare record plans at closeout.

Architecture Plans Frequently Asked Questions
How long does it usually to prepare a full set of architecture plans?
Timeline varies based on design requirements. Smaller residential projects like ADU builds often run four to eight weeks from kickoff to permit submittal. Multi-story projects such as multi-unit developments often take three to six months to bring to permit-ready status. Our architects will share a realistic completion window at your initial meeting.
What should I budget for architecture plans in Walnut Creek?
Cost depends heavily by design complexity. Single-room additions may cost approximately a few thousand dollars, while complex multi-unit buildings can involve significantly higher design investments. Will the architecture plans need to carry a license seal by a licensed architect?
In most cases, yes. California building codes mandate that drawings for structural work bear the seal and authorization of a California-licensed architect or licensed engineer. Can architecture plans be changed after submission?
Yes, but modifications once filed initiate a design amendment with the permit office, which creates delays.
